How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gateway?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Gateway Studio Apartments | $1,359 | $775 | $1,538 |
Gateway 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,318 | $429 | $1,815 |
Gateway 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,685 | $515 | $2,235 |
Gateway 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,885 | $929 | $2,125 |
Gateway 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,505 | $1,195 | $1,750 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gateway
How much are Studio apartments in Gateway?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Gateway with rent ranges from $775 to $1,538 with an average price of $1,359.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Gateway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Gateway ranges from $429 to $1,815 with an average monthly rent of $1,318.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Gateway c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Gateway range from $515 to $2,235.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,685.
